Background
Apoplexy is also called cerebral apoplexy and cerebral apoplexy, and has the characteristics of high morbidity, high disability rate and high death rate. Patients reach emergency treatment to intravenous thrombolysis treatment target value (DNT) within 60 minutes, so efficient emergency measures are important to improve the long-term quality of life of stroke patients.
The existing treatment vehicle for clinical application cannot meet the requirements of instruments and equipment and medicines required in the stroke rescue process due to single structure and function, and medical workers often need to take objects back and forth for multiple times, so that the rescue efficiency is directly influenced; in addition, although the patients with apoplexy are diagnosed through imaging examination, the patients need to return to an emergency rescue room or a apoplexy unit for thrombolysis treatment due to the lack of emergency equipment and medicines, so that the phenomenon of delay in hospital is increased.

The utility model discloses owing to adopted above-mentioned technical scheme, make it compare the positive effect that has with prior art to be:
(1) through right the utility model discloses an use, compare with conventional treatment car, compact structure, occupation space is little. The storage part is divided into a plurality of storage spaces, and the storage spaces are respectively placed in different storage spaces according to the use and management requirements of different medicines and appliances, so that the storage spaces can be expanded, and the use of the apoplexy common first-aid materials such as medicines, articles and monitoring equipment is basically met, thereby reducing the times of taking articles back and forth of medical personnel during rescue, improving the rescue efficiency and reducing the workload of the medical personnel.
(2) Through right the utility model discloses an use, be furnished with fourth storing space and take locking device for place high-risk, precious medicine, strengthened the safety control of high-risk, precious medicine.
(3) Through right the utility model discloses an use, have the precious medicine that the thrombolysis was used frequently of apoplexy: an alteplase injection. Make the cerebral apoplexy patient need dissolve the thrombus treatment after CT inspection when, can carry out bedside vein thrombolysis in the CT room the very first time and dispense and inject, eliminated and transported to the institute of rescue room invalid time by the CT room, greatly simplified the interior treatment link of institute, strived for rescue time for the patient, improved the thrombolysis success rate.
(4) Through right the utility model discloses an use, realize the disposable classification of medical discarded object, satisfy the classification requirement of medical discarded object. The annular supporting ring is used for placing the sharps box, so that the sharps used in the rescue process can be directly contained like an injection needle, the occurrence of needle stick injuries is reduced, and the occurrence of nosocomial infection is avoided. The lower layer space is provided with a pedal type garbage can for containing medical wastes, medical workers can directly classify and treat the medical wastes generated in the rescue process, the operation of retreating the medical wastes after the rescue is finished is avoided, and the workload of the medical workers is reduced; and the operation of bending down is not needed, thereby conforming to the mechanics of human body.

Detailed Description
The present invention will be further described with reference to the accompanying drawings and specific embodiments, but the present invention is not limited thereto.
As shown in fig. 1, there is shown a multifunctional treatment cart for stroke rescue of a preferred embodiment, comprising: a moving part and a vehicle body. The moving part is arranged at the lower end of the vehicle body; wherein, the automobile body includes: the bottom plate 4 is a horizontally arranged plate-shaped structure; the support rods 3 are arranged in the vertical direction, the lower end of each support rod 3 is fixedly arranged at the upper end of the bottom plate 4, and the support rods 3 are uniformly distributed around the outer edge of the bottom plate 4; the placing plate 2 is arranged above the bottom plate 4, the placing plate 2 is arranged parallel to the bottom plate 4, the outer edge of the placing plate 2 is fixedly connected with the middle parts of the plurality of supporting rods 3, and a first placing space is formed on the placing plate 2; the drawer structure 1 is arranged above the placing plate 2, and the upper ends of the plurality of support rods 3 are fixed on the lower surface of the drawer structure 1; the drawer structure comprises a surrounding wall structure 5, wherein the surrounding wall structure 5 is arranged on the upper surface of the drawer structure 1, the surrounding wall structure 5 is arranged around the outer edge of the upper surface of the drawer structure 1, and a second placing space is formed on the upper surface of the drawer structure 1; at least one annular supporting ring 6, the annular supporting ring 6 is fixedly arranged on the supporting rod 3.
Further, as a preferred embodiment, the drawer structure 1 includes: the drawer comprises a drawer shell, drawer boxes 1-1, drawer door plates 1-3 and handles 1-2, wherein the drawer shell is of a rectangular shell structure, the lower surface of the drawer shell is fixedly connected with the upper end of each support rod 3, an installation space is formed in the drawer shell, an outlet is formed in one side of the drawer shell, the drawer boxes 1-1 are installed in the drawer shell in a push-and-pull mode along the outlet, the drawer door plates 1-3 are installed on one side of the drawer boxes 1-1, the drawer door plates 1-3 are matched with the outlet, and the handles 1-2 are embedded in the other side, opposite to the drawer boxes 1-1, of the drawer door plates 1-3.
Further, as a preferred embodiment, the drawer box 1-1 is of a box body structure with an open upper portion, an accommodating space is formed in the drawer box 1-1, and a first partition plate 11, a second partition plate 12, a third partition plate 13, a fourth partition plate 14 and a fifth partition plate 15 are vertically arranged in the drawer box 1-1; the first partition plate 11 and the second partition plate 12 are arranged in parallel in the accommodating space, and the accommodating space is sequentially divided into a first storage space, a second storage space and a third storage space through the first partition plate 11 and the second partition plate 12; the third partition plate 13 and the fourth partition plate 14 are arranged in the first storage space in parallel, and both the third partition plate 13 and the fourth partition plate 14 are perpendicular to the first partition plate 11; the fifth partition 15 is disposed in the third storage space, and the fifth partition 15 is perpendicular to the second partition 12.
Further, as a preferred embodiment, at least one of the support rods 3 has a circular cross section, and the annular ring 6 includes: top circle, foundation ring and mount, the equal level setting of top circle and foundation ring, top circle and foundation ring are cyclic annular structure, and top circle and the coaxial setting of foundation ring set up in the upper end of one side of mount, and the foundation ring sets up in the lower extreme of one side of mount, and the mount includes: vertical support, two centre gripping connecting portion, fixing bolt and fixation nut, the upper end and the top ring of one side of vertical support are connected, and the lower extreme and the foundation ring of one side of vertical support are connected, and two centre gripping connecting portion are fixed in the opposite side of vertical support, and two centre gripping connecting portion set up in same level, and the arc wall has all been opened on one side surface that two centre gripping connecting portion are close to each other, the outer wall both sides phase-match of arc wall and bracing piece, and fixing bolt runs through two centre gripping connecting portion and is connected with fixation nut. Furthermore, the top ring and the bottom ring are both of annular structures, and the diameter of the top ring is larger than that of the bottom ring.
Further, as a preferred embodiment, the upper surface of the drawer structure 1 is rectangular, and the enclosure wall structure 5 includes: four spliced poles and four connecting rods, each spliced pole all sets up in the upper surface of drawer structure 1 along vertical direction, and the four spliced poles set up respectively in the four corners department of drawer structure 1's upper surface, and all is equipped with a connecting rod between every two adjacent spliced poles, and each connecting rod all sets up along the horizontal direction, and leaves certain space between the upper surface of each connecting rod and drawer structure 1. Furthermore, the medical staff can push the treatment cart by holding the enclosure wall with hands, so that the enclosure wall structure 5 can be used as a pushing handle of the treatment cart besides providing the second placing space. Further, as a preferred embodiment, the lower extreme of each bracing piece 3 all runs through bottom plate 4 and sets up, and the lower extreme of each bracing piece 3 all slightly protrudes in the lower surface setting of bottom plate 4, and the removal portion includes a plurality of universal wheels 8, and each universal wheel 8 all installs in the lower extreme of a bracing piece 3.
Further, as a preferred embodiment, the upper surface of the bottom plate 4 is recessed to form a mounting groove.
Further, as a preferred embodiment, a garbage bin 7 is installed in the installation groove. In particular, the trash can includes, but is not limited to, being usable to contain medical waste.
Further, as a preferred embodiment, the drawer box 1-1 further includes: a fourth storage space is enclosed by the storage cover 9, the first partition plate 11, the third partition plate 13, the fourth partition plate 14 and one side wall of the drawer box 1-1, and the storage cover 9 is matched with the upper part of the fourth storage space. Specifically, the storage cover 9 may be openably disposed at an upper portion of the fourth storage space through a hinge structure, and the fourth storage space is relatively closed by closing the storage cover. Specifically, the storage cover is also provided with a lock ring, and the fourth storage space is isolated from the outside by a lock head in an operable mode and used for storing high-risk articles.
